Urban horticulture holds immense relevance for a number of reasons. It brings forth environmental benefits such as enhanced air quality, minimized urban warmth island effect, and stormwater drainage reduction. Engaging in metropolitan gardening uses various benefits, from promoting health and wellness and well-being with physical exercise and anxiety decrease while cultivating a connection with nature to financial savings by minimizing grocery expenses and reducing food waste.


Fresh food ranges offer fundamental supplements, and growing itself can diminish wellness wagers and improve mental wellness. Urban gardening can provide convenience from the turmoil of city life and reduce anxiety. Preserving eco-friendly rooms in urban setups supplies homeowners access to nature and enhances ecological health. In built-up locations that would certainly or else be all concrete, city gardeners can produce greenspace, which is essential for wild animals.

Engaging metropolitan children in growing their food can assist educate them an important lesson concerning just how it is grown. A tactical urban garden can help with lowering rain runoff and flooding in metropolitan neighborhoods by reducing the number of bulletproof surface areas that can not soak up rainwater. Because of the metropolitan warmth island result, cities are generally hotter than surrounding locations.


Urban yards come in various types. Rooftop gardens use extra rooftop areas, supplying an ideal setting for growing plants and vegetables. Terrace and balcony yards use an environment-friendly retreat within city homes and condominiums. Community gardens bring people together to grow common rooms, fostering a sense of area and food protection.

Area establishes the type of metropolitan ranch you'll run, so do your research to determine what is and isn't permitted in your preferred room. Whether you're considering beginning a city yard at home or for the neighborhood, analyze what kind would serve you finest. Assess the sort of garden that would certainly deal with the certain problems of your home or area.


If you have accessibility to exterior space, bear in mind of the sunshine, square video footage, and accessibility to water. In limited urban environments, observe and note any type of trees, structures, or other obstructions that may cast shadows on your yard throughout the expanding period. Prevent growing veggies or flowering plants that need brilliant light in low-light areas and the other way around.


Make use of top quality dirt and appropriate containers to make certain healthy and balanced plant development. Water your yard regularly and ensure proper drainage to stop waterlogging. Practice buddy planting and crop turning to optimize plant health and minimise insects. Commit time to routine maintenance and execute insect control approaches as required. Pick your horticulture technique based on the outcomes you obtain from evaluating your area and needs.

Natural herbs and salad environment-friendlies are prominent because of their compact dimension and quick development. Tomatoes and peppers flourish in city yards and provide bountiful harvests. Root veggies, such as carrots and radishes, can be grown in containers or elevated beds. Climbing up plants like beans and cucumbers can be trained on trellises to optimize vertical room.


Urban yards frequently take advantage of warmer microclimates, enabling the cultivation of much less durable plants such as palms and bamboo commonly found in warmer regions. And as we have actually said, do not simply go with little plants; tiny urban yards can deal with big plants and trees and picking these over small fussy hedges will certainly make the area really feel larger and much more interesting.


Make use of large containers they don't completely dry out as promptly as smaller pots, so they are less work to maintain water. Vertical farming and aeroponics enable plants to be expanded in regulated settings, making use of very little area and sources. IoT-based innovative horticulture systems make it possible for remote surveillance and automation of horticulture procedures. Urban farming apps and online resources provide valuable details, pointers, and area assistance for metropolitan garden enthusiasts. Area gardens are semi-public spaces shared by a neighborhood of next-door neighbors and various other people where they collectively join expanding fruits, veggies, or blossoms, sharing labor and harvest. It's great to get involved in these sustainable jobs as they're just as valuable for you, the community, and the environment. Community gardens are found in neighborhoods, but can also be created in schools, domestic lands, or institutions, such as healthcare facilities.
